@charset "iso-8859-1";

/* author: shenancalhar www.shadoweyez.com.ph */
/* Creation date: 8/8/2007 */


body{
				text-align: center;
				margin: 0; padding: 0;
				font-size: 100%;
				background: white url(images/wpage-bg.gif) top center repeat-y;
}

#wrapper{
				margin: 0 auto;
				position: relative;
				width: 630px;
				height:900px;
				text-align: left;
				background: white;	
				z-index:5;
}

#headerdiv{
					width: 629px;
					height:300px;
					background: black url(images/vampiredude.jpg) no-repeat; background-position: left top;
					padding: 0px;
					position: absolute;
					top:0px;
					left:0px;
					z-index:2;
}

#bodywrapper{
					width: 510px;
					height: 879px;
					background: white url(images/MoonlitCity.jpg) no-repeat; background-position: right bottom;
					position: absolute;
					top: 324px;
					left: 120px;
					border-width: 1px;
					border-style: solid;
					border-color: silver;
					overflow: auto;
					font-family: tahoma,verdana,arial;		
					font-size:0.9em;		
					padding:0px;	
					z-index:6;	
}

#bodywrapper cite{
					display: block;
					font: bold 55%/120% Verdana, Sans-Serif;
					color: navy;
					text-align: right;
					font-variant: small-caps
}

#footerwrapper{
					width: 630px;
					height:63px;
					background: white;
					position: absolute;
					top: 1200px;
					left: 0px;
					border-width: 1px;
					border-style: solid;
					border-color: silver;
					z-index:1;
					
}

#navwrapper {
					width: 120px;
					height:879px;
					background: black url(images/menubg.jpg) no-repeat;background-position: left top;
					position: relative;
					top: 300px;
					left: 0px;
					border-width: 1px;
					border-style: solid;
					border-color: silver;
					z-index:3;
}

#navmainmenu {
					width: 630px;
					height:20px;
					background: black;
					position: relative;
					top: 300px;
					left: 0px;
					border-width: 1px;
					border-style: solid;
					border-color: silver;
					text-align: right;		
					z-index:4;		
}

#navblock1 {
					width: 120px;
					background: black;
					position: relative;
					top: 240px;
					left: 0px;
					margin: 0 auto 0 auto;
}

#navblock2 {
					width: 120px;
					margin: 0 auto 0 auto;
					background: black;
					position: relative;
					top: 240px;
					left: 0px;
}

#navblock3 {
					width: 120px;
					margin: 0 auto 0 auto;
					background: black;
					position: relative;
					top: 240px;
					left: 0px;
}

#navheadermenu1 {

					width: 120px;
					height: 20px;
					background: silver;
					position: relative;
					top: 240px;
					left: 0px;
					color: black;
					text-align: center;
					font-family: tahoma,verdana,arial;												
}

#navheadermenu2 {

					width: 120px;
					height: 20px;
					background: silver;
					position: relative;
					top: 240px;
					left: 0px;
					color: black;
					text-align: center;
					font-family: tahoma,verdana,arial;												
}

#navheadermenu3 {

					width: 120px;
					height: 20px;
					background: silver;
					position: relative;
					top: 240px;
					left: 0px;
					color: black;
					text-align: center;
					font-family: tahoma,verdana,arial;												
}

#uleftdiv{
				position: absolute; 
				left: 0px; 
				top:0px; 
				height:300px; 
				width: 180px; 
				padding: 0.5em;
				z-index:2;
				background: black url(images/upperleftlogo.jpg) no-repeat;
}

#urightdiv{
				position: absolute; 
				right: 0px; 
				top:0px; 
				height:200px; 
				width: 150px; 
				padding: 0.5em;
				z-index:2;
				background: black url(images/upperrightlogo.jpg) no-repeat;
}

#lleftdiv{
				position: absolute; 
				left: 0px; 
				bottom:-180px; 
				height:70px; 
				width: 80px; 
				padding: 0.5em;
				z-index:2;
				background: white url(images/lowerleftlogo.jpg) no-repeat;
}

#lrightdiv{
				position: absolute; 
				right: 0px; 
				bottom:-180px; 
				height:280px; 
				width: 90px; 
				padding: 0.5em;
				z-index:2;
				background: white url(images/lowerightlogo.jpg) no-repeat;
}

#maindiv {
					width: 800px;
					height:700px;
					background: black;
					padding: 5px;
					position:absolute;
					top:0px;
					left:50px;
					z-index:1;
					margin:0;
}


/* every paragraph */
p{ 
					font-family: Tahoma,Verdana,Arial,Helvetica,Sans-serif;
					font-size: 0.9em;
					text-indent:25px;
					color:black;
					margin-right:2px;
					margin-top:10px;
					margin-bottom:10px;
					margin-left:2px;					
}

/* every header */
h1{
					font-family: tahoma,verdana,arial; 
					font-variant: small-caps;
					color:red; 
					text-decoration:none;
					letter-spacing:3px;
					font-size: 1.2em;	
					text-indent:10px;
}

b{ 
					font-family: chiller,Verdana,Arial,Helvetica,Sans-serif;
					font-size: 1.5em;
					color:red;
}

ul.pool{
					list-style-image: url(http://www.geocities.com/shadow3y3z/image/bullet.gif);
}

li{
					font-family: tahoma,verdana,arial; 
					font-variant: small-caps;
					color:black; 
					text-decoration:none;
					font-size: 0.9em;	
}

ol{
					text-indent:10px;
}

/* links and hovers for nav */

a.nav:link{
					font-family: tahoma,verdana,arial; 
					font-variant: small-caps;
					color: gray; 
					text-decoration:none;
					font-size: 1.2em;
}

a.nav:visited{		
					font-family: tahoma,verdana,arial;
					font-variant: small-caps;					
					color: silver;
					text-decoration:none;
					font-size: 1.2em;	
}

a.nav:hover{		
					font-family: tahoma,verdana,arial;
					font-variant: small-caps;					
					color: red; 
					text-decoration:none;
					font-size: 1.2em;					
					
}

a.nav:active{		
					font-family: tahoma,verdana,arial;
					font-variant: small-caps;					
 					color: white;
					text-decoration:none;
					font-size: 1.2em;
}


/* links and hovers for others */

a.body:link{
					font-family: tahoma,verdana,arial; 
					font-variant: small-caps;
					color: red; 
					text-decoration:none;
					font-size: 1.0em;	
}

a.body:visited{		
					font-family: tahoma,verdana,arial;
					font-variant: small-caps;					
					color:red;
					text-decoration:none;
					font-size: 1.0em;	
}

a.body:hover{		
					font-family: tahoma,verdana,arial;
					font-variant: small-caps;					
					color: silver; 
					text-decoration:none;
					font-size: 1.0em;			
					
}

a.body:active{		
					font-family: tahoma,verdana,arial;
					font-variant: small-caps;					
 					color: gray;
					text-decoration:none;
					font-size: 1.0em;	
}


/* Classes */

.headerhighlight{
					font-family: verdana,arial;
					font-variant: small-caps;					
 					color: blue;
					text-decoration:none;
					font-size: 0.9em;
}
.footer{
					font-family: tahoma,verdana,arial;
					font-variant: small-caps;					
 					color:black;
					text-decoration:none;
					font-size: 0.7em;
}

.titleblock {	
				font-family:verdana, helvetica, sans serif;
				font-variant: small-caps;	
				
				font-size:15;
				color: green;
				margin-right:2px;
				margin-top:10px;
				margin-bottom:10px;
				margin-left:2px;
				border:1px solid silver;
				padding:1px;
}

.softwareblock {	
				font-family: tahoma,verdana, helvetica, sans-serif;
				font-size:0.9em;
				color: black;
				margin-right:5px;
				margin-top:5px;
				margin-bottom:5px;
				margin-left:2px;
				background: transparent;
				padding:4px
}

/*----- FORM ----- */

input   {
	border-top: 1pt solid #cccccc;
	border-bottom: 1pt solid #cccccc;
	border-right: 1pt solid #cccccc;
	border-left: 1pt solid #cccccc;
	font: normal 10px tahoma;
	width:115px;
	color: #707070;
}

textarea.sidebar   {
	border-top: 1pt solid #cccccc;
	border-bottom: 1pt solid #cccccc;
	border-right: 1pt solid #cccccc;
	border-left: 1pt solid #cccccc;
	font: normal 10px tahoma;
	width:115px;
	height:80px;
	color: #707070;
}

input.sidebar   {
	border-top: 1pt solid #cccccc;
	border-bottom: 1pt solid #cccccc;
	border-right: 1pt solid #cccccc;
	border-left: 1pt solid #cccccc;
	font: normal 10px tahoma;
	width:115px;
	color: #707070;
}

input.button_sidebar   {
	border-top: 1pt solid #cccccc;
	border-bottom: 1pt solid #cccccc;
	border-right: 1pt solid #cccccc;
	border-left: 1pt solid #cccccc;
	font: normal 10px tahoma;
	width:119px;
	color: #707070;
}

input.button_content   {
	border-top: 1pt solid #cccccc;
	border-bottom: 1pt solid #cccccc;
	border-right: 1pt solid #cccccc;
	border-left: 1pt solid #cccccc;
	font: normal 10px tahoma;
	width:119px;
	color: #707070;
}

